The ingredients needed to make Keto Gluten-Free Italian Meatballs:
- Use 2 lbs 80/20 ground beef
- Provide 2 eggs
- Take 1 onion chopped fine
- Use 3/4 C almond flour
- Take 5 cloves minced garlic
- Provide 1/3 C grated parmesan
- Prepare 1 beef bouillon cube, broken up
- Prepare 1/2 tsp each of oregano and Italian seasoning
- You need 1 jar low net carb spaghetti sauce
Steps to make Keto Gluten-Free Italian Meatballs:
- Mix all ingredients together.
- Brown meatballs in olive oil on both sides and transfer to cookie sheet.
- Bake at 400 degrees for 15 minutes.
- Add to pot of sauce and heat.
- Top with grated parmesan. They can be used to top shiritake noodles if desired.
- This is the sauce I use. It is 3 net carbs per 1/2 cup.
- To cut down on the acid of the tomatoes, you can add a tablespoon of red wine to sauce.
